Working in Parliament ‘to have spirituality and spiritual care explicitly acknowledged in health and social care changes'

This paper reinforces the view that it is essential to find ways to widen the sphere of public concern and to influence the institutional mechanisms that bring about policy change with regard to an understanding of spirituality. It describes how spirituality and spiritual care were addressed during...
